No. 1 Tennessee suffers first loss at Georgia

No. 3 Tennessee (8-1, 4-1 SEC) suffered its first loss of the 2022 season at No. 1 Georgia (9-0. 6-0 SEC) Saturday.

Rankings reflect the USA TODAY Sports AFCA Coaches Poll.

The Vols are No. 1 in the College Football Playoff rankings, while Georgia is No. 3.

Georgia defeated Tennessee, 27-13.

The victory gives Georgia sole possession of first place in the SEC East and ends Tennessee’s eight-game win streak.

The Vols scored first in the contest. Chase McGrath converted a 47-yard field goal with 10 minutes, 5 seconds remaining in the first quarter.

McGarath’s field goal was set up when Tamarion McDonald recovered a Bulldogs’ fumble.

Georgia then scored 21 unanswered points.

Quarterback Stetson Bennett’s 18-yard scoring run and two passing touchdowns passes gave the Bulldogs a 21-3 lead.

McGrath converted a 36-yard field in the second quarter to pull Tennessee within 21-6.

Georgia’s Jack Podlesny converted a 19-yard field goal on the final play of the first half to give Georgia a 24-6 lead at halftime.

Georgia scored the only points in the third quarter, converting a 38-yard field goal by Podlesny.

Jaylen Wright scored on a 5-yard rushing touchdown with 4:15 remaining in the game.
